The Manager of Operations works with and directs employees with regard to collections. The Manager of Operations is responsible for all High-Risk transactions as defined by the Department. The Manager of Operations is responsible for their actions and the actions of all team members reporting to them. The Manager of Operations is responsible for managing assigned consumer care employees performance to ensure a balance of optimum productivity and collection goals and budgets are met; coach, develop, and counsel subordinates to achieve quality performance, providing ongoing training when necessary; manage the activities involved in quality resolution of performance and profitability issues relating to assigned consumer care employees, and escalate to management any situation outside the employee's control that could adversely impact the service provided; prepare and update reports in a timely and accurate manner ensuring deadlines are met.
